Every great region has at least one extraordinary individual that champions its unique character and terroir. In Verzy, that person is Sébastien Mouzon, an absolute dynamo, producing beautiful, incisive, and mineral Champagnes.

As part of the “third wave” of visionary grower-producers, Sébastien crafts some of the most vibrant, mineral-driven Champagnes known to us. With a family legacy dating back to 1776, Sébastien embraced biodynamics in 2008, witnessing a remarkable improvement in wine purity. His commitment to sustainable practices is evident in his agroforestry efforts, boasting over 1,000 trees on the estate. Cultivating 60 plots across Verzy’s diverse terroirs, Sébastien’s artisanal approach, extended lees aging, and minimal intervention result in restrained, elegant, and captivating Champagnes. Disgorged October 2022. The Angélique is a Blanc de Blancs sourced from between four and eight sites in Verzy, depending on the year. These sites are located in the first and second valleys, where the plantings are more heavily skewed to Chardonnay and the soils are rich in clay, limestone and flint. The wine sees full malo, a 60-month élevage in oak and 1.5g/l dosage.
